Method

Preparation

  1. 1

    Prepare the Au Jus

    In a saucepan, heat the beef broth over medium heat. Season with salt and black pepper to taste. Let it simmer for about 10 minutes to enhance the flavor.

  2. 2

    Sauté the Roast Beef

    In a sk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the sliced roast beef and cook until warmed through, about 5 minutes. If desired, you can season with additional salt and pepper.

  3. 3

    Assemble the Sandwich

    Slice the poorboy buns in half. Pile the warm roast beef on the bottom half of each bun. Spread a teaspoon of horseradish on top of the beef to taste, then place the other half of the bun on top.

  4. 4

    Serve

    Serve the sandwiches hot with a small bowl of au jus on the side for dipping.
